Historical Overview of ASEAN-EU Relations
The ASEAN-EU partnership formally began in 1977, initially focusing on trade and development cooperation. Over the decades, the relationship has broadened significantly, encompassing a wide range of areas, including political dialogue, security cooperation, and people-to-people exchanges. Key Milestones in the ASEAN-EU Partnership
- 1977: Establishment of formal dialogue relations.
- 1980: First ASEAN-EU Summit.
- 2007: Elevation of the relationship to a Strategic Partnership.
- 2020: Virtual ASEAN-EU Summit reaffirming commitment to multilateralism.
Economic Cooperation between ASEAN and the EU
Trade and investment are cornerstones of the ASEAN-EU partnership. Both sides have worked to reduce trade barriers and promote investment flows.
What are the main sectors of economic cooperation?
Key sectors of cooperation include manufacturing, tourism, information technology, and renewable energy. The EU has also supported ASEAN’s regional integration efforts, contributing to the development of the ASEAN Economic Community (AEC).
Political and Security Cooperation
Beyond economics, ASEAN and the EU engage in regular political and security dialogues. Both sides also work together to promote regional stability and peaceful conflict resolution.
How do ASEAN and the EU cooperate on security issues?
ASEAN and the EU share a commitment to multilateralism and a rules-based international order. They cooperate within international forums such as the United Nations and the G20 to address global challenges.
